Reports 2002  >  Corporate Responsibility  >  Health and Safety  >  Safety Programmes
In Finland, much emphasis has been placed on early rehabilitation, to ensure that employees showing signs of diminished working ability have the opportunity to attend a week-long early rehabilitation course when needed. The course prioritises proactive measures to maintain and improve mental and physical working capacity, with tailor-made support and follow-up provided by Stora Enso's occupational health care professionals.

A new programme has also been launched in Finland focusing on increasing safety awareness among contractors and suppliers. When the system is fully applied, everyone employed by a contractor or supplier will have to attend safety and security training, followed by an examination, before receiving a safety pass to work at a Stora Enso site. A similar process is ongoing in Stora Enso units in North America.

Much emphasis has been put on accident prevention, and many units have been successful in this area. For example no accidents resulting in lost work days had taken place at the Langerbrugge Mill for a period of 18 months by the end of 2002.
